Executive Transition Announcement


Day One Biopharmaceuticals announces the retirement of its Head of Research & Development, Samuel Blackman, effective at the end of 2024.

Summary

  • Day One Biopharmaceuticals has announced that Samuel Blackman, M.D., Ph.D., will retire from his position as Head of Research & Development at the end of 2024.
  • Dr. Blackman is a co-founder of the company and has held the Head of Research & Development role since May 2023.
  • He previously served as the company's Chief Medical Officer since its founding.
  • Dr. Blackman will transition to a strategic advisor and consultant role while the company searches for a new Head of Research & Development.
  • The company expressed gratitude for Dr. Blackman's service and contributions.
